Index: LayoutTests/scrollbars/custom-scrollbar-thumb-width-changed-on-inactive-pseudo.html |
diff --git a/LayoutTests/scrollbars/custom-scrollbar-thumb-width-changed-on-inactive-pseudo.html b/LayoutTests/scrollbars/custom-scrollbar-thumb-width-changed-on-inactive-pseudo.html |
new file mode 100644 |
index 0000000000000000000000000000000000000000..a856bf763a9109f3e56dd15d6aa5d5677ac043e7 |
--- /dev/null |
+++ b/LayoutTests/scrollbars/custom-scrollbar-thumb-width-changed-on-inactive-pseudo.html |
@@ -0,0 +1,124 @@ |
+<style> |
+html { |
+ overflow: auto; |
+} |
+body { |
+ position: absolute; |
+ top: 20px; |
+ left: 20px; |
+ bottom: 20px; |
+ right: 20px; |
+ padding: 30px; |
+ overflow-y: scroll; |
+ overflow-x: scroll; |
+} |
+::-webkit-scrollbar { |
+ width: 12px; |
+ height: 12px; |
+} |
+::-webkit-scrollbar-track { |
+ -webkit-box-shadow: inset 0 0 6px rgba(0,0,0,0.3); |
+ -webkit-border-radius: 10px; |
+ border-radius: 10px; |
+} |
+::-webkit-scrollbar-thumb { |
+ -webkit-border-radius: 10px; |
+ border-radius: 10px; |
+ background: rgba(255,0,0,0.8); |
+ -webkit-box-shadow: inset 0 0 6px rgba(0,0,0,0.5); |
+} |
+::-webkit-scrollbar-thumb:window-inactive { |
+ background: rgba(255,0,0,0.4); |
+} |
+::-webkit-scrollbar:window-inactive { |
+ width: 100px; |
+ height: 100px; |
+} |
+div { |
+ width: 300px; |
+ height: 300px; |
+ border: thin solid black; |
+ overflow: scroll; |
+} |
+</style> |
+<body> |
+<div> |
+<p style="height:350px"> |
+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. |
+Vestibulum tortor quam, feugiat vitae, ultricies eget, tempor sit amet, ante. Donec eu libero |
+sit amet quam egestas semper. Aenean ultricies mi vitae est. Mauris placerat eleifend leo. |
+Quisque sit amet est et sapien ullamcorper pharetra. Vestibulum erat wisi, condimentum sed, |
+commodo vitae, ornare sit amet, wisi. Aenean fermentum, elit eget tincidunt condimentum, |
+e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. Donec non enim in turpis pulvinar |
+facilisis. Ut felis. Praesent dapibus, neque id cursus faucibus, tortor neque egestas augue, |
+eu vulputate magna eros eu erat. Aliquam erat volutpat. Nam dui mi, tincidunt quis, accumsan |
+porttitor, facilisis luctus, metus.Pellentesque habitant morbi tristique senectus et netus |
+et malesuada fames ac turpis egestas.Vestibulum tortor quam, feugiat vitae, ultricies eget, |
+tempor sit amet, ante. Donec eu libero sit amet quam egestas semper. Aenean ultricies mi |
+vitae est. Mauris placerat eleifend leo. Quisque sit amet est et sapien ullamcorper pharetra. |
+Vestibulum erat wisi, condimentum sed, commodo vitae, ornare sit amet, wisi. Aenean fermentum, |
+elit eget tincidunt condimentum, e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. |
+Donec non enim in turpis pulvinar facilisis. Ut felis. Praesent dapibus, neque id cursus |
+faucibus, tortor neque egestas augue,eu vulputate magna eros eu erat. Aliquam erat volutpat. |
+Nam dui mi, tincidunt quis, accumsan porttitor, facilisis luctus, metus. |
+</p> |
+</div> |
+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. |
+Vestibulum tortor quam, feugiat vitae, ultricies eget, tempor sit amet, ante. Donec eu libero |
+sit amet quam egestas semper. Aenean ultricies mi vitae est. Mauris placerat eleifend leo. |
+Quisque sit amet est et sapien ullamcorper pharetra. Vestibulum erat wisi, condimentum sed, |
+commodo vitae, ornare sit amet, wisi. Aenean fermentum, elit eget tincidunt condimentum, |
+e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. Donec non enim in turpis pulvinar |
+facilisis. Ut felis. Praesent dapibus, neque id cursus faucibus, tortor neque egestas augue, |
+eu vulputate magna eros eu erat. Aliquam erat volutpat. Nam dui mi, tincidunt quis, accumsan |
+porttitor, facilisis luctus, metus.Pellentesque habitant morbi tristique senectus et netus |
+et malesuada fames ac turpis egestas.Vestibulum tortor quam, feugiat vitae, ultricies eget, |
+tempor sit amet, ante. Donec eu libero sit amet quam egestas semper. Aenean ultricies mi |
+vitae est. Mauris placerat eleifend leo. Quisque sit amet est et sapien ullamcorper pharetra. |
+Vestibulum erat wisi, condimentum sed, commodo vitae, ornare sit amet, wisi. Aenean fermentum, |
+elit eget tincidunt condimentum, e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. |
+Donec non enim in turpis pulvinar facilisis. Ut felis. Praesent dapibus, neque id cursus |
+faucibus, tortor neque egestas augue,eu vulputate magna eros eu erat. Aliquam erat volutpat. |
+Nam dui mi, tincidunt quis, accumsan porttitor, facilisis luctus, metus. |
+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. |
+Vestibulum tortor quam, feugiat vitae, ultricies eget, tempor sit amet, ante. Donec eu libero |
+sit amet quam egestas semper. Aenean ultricies mi vitae est. Mauris placerat eleifend leo. |
+Quisque sit amet est et sapien ullamcorper pharetra. Vestibulum erat wisi, condimentum sed, |
+commodo vitae, ornare sit amet, wisi. Aenean fermentum, elit eget tincidunt condimentum, |
+e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. Donec non enim in turpis pulvinar |
+facilisis. Ut felis. Praesent dapibus, neque id cursus faucibus, tortor neque egestas augue, |
+eu vulputate magna eros eu erat. Aliquam erat volutpat. Nam dui mi, tincidunt quis, accumsan |
+porttitor, facilisis luctus, metus.Pellentesque habitant morbi tristique senectus et netus |
+et malesuada fames ac turpis egestas.Vestibulum tortor quam, feugiat vitae, ultricies eget, |
+tempor sit amet, ante. Donec eu libero sit amet quam egestas semper. Aenean ultricies mi |
+vitae est. Mauris placerat eleifend leo. Quisque sit amet est et sapien ullamcorper pharetra. |
+Vestibulum erat wisi, condimentum sed, commodo vitae, ornare sit amet, wisi. Aenean fermentum, |
+elit eget tincidunt condimentum, e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. |
+Donec non enim in turpis pulvinar facilisis. Ut felis. Praesent dapibus, neque id cursus |
+faucibus, tortor neque egestas augue,eu vulputate magna eros eu erat. Aliquam erat volutpat. |
+Nam dui mi, tincidunt quis, accumsan porttitor, facilisis luctus, metus. |
+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. |
+Vestibulum tortor quam, feugiat vitae, ultricies eget, tempor sit amet, ante. Donec eu libero |
+sit amet quam egestas semper. Aenean ultricies mi vitae est. Mauris placerat eleifend leo. |
+Quisque sit amet est et sapien ullamcorper pharetra. Vestibulum erat wisi, condimentum sed, |
+commodo vitae, ornare sit amet, wisi. Aenean fermentum, elit eget tincidunt condimentum, |
+e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. Donec non enim in turpis pulvinar |
+facilisis. Ut felis. Praesent dapibus, neque id cursus faucibus, tortor neque egestas augue, |
+eu vulputate magna eros eu erat. Aliquam erat volutpat. Nam dui mi, tincidunt quis, accumsan |
+porttitor, facilisis luctus, metus.Pellentesque habitant morbi tristique senectus et netus |
+et malesuada fames ac turpis egestas.Vestibulum tortor quam, feugiat vitae, ultricies eget, |
+tempor sit amet, ante. Donec eu libero sit amet quam egestas semper. Aenean ultricies mi |
+vitae est. Mauris placerat eleifend leo. Quisque sit amet est et sapien ullamcorper pharetra. |
+Vestibulum erat wisi, condimentum sed, commodo vitae, ornare sit amet, wisi. Aenean fermentum, |
+elit eget tincidunt condimentum, eros ipsum rutrum orci, sagittis tempus lacus enim ac dui. |
+Donec non enim in turpis pulvinar facilisis. Ut felis. Praesent dapibus, neque id cursus |
+faucibus, tortor neque egestas augue,eu vulputate magna eros eu erat. Aliquam erat volutpat. |
+Nam dui mi, tincidunt quis, accumsan porttitor, facilisis luctus, metus. |
+</body> |
+<script> |
+window.onload = function() { |
+// setWindowIsKey shall set the focus of the window. |
+if (window.testRunner) |
+ window.testRunner.setWindowIsKey(false); |
+} |
+</script> |